Understanding the Core Mechanics of the Road Crossing Challenge

The fundamental gameplay of a chicken crossing game revolves around timing. Players control a chicken whose sole objective is to reach the other side of a road filled with moving vehicles. The speed and frequency of these vehicles vary, creating a dynamic and unpredictable environment. Success isn't about brute force or speed, but about identifying gaps in traffic and executing precisely timed movements. Each successful crossing builds confidence, while each failed attempt serves as a learning experience, encouraging players to refine their strategies and improve their reaction times. The game often incorporates an increasing difficulty curve, introducing faster vehicles, more lanes of traffic, or even obstacles beyond just cars and trucks. This progression keeps the experience fresh and prevents it from becoming monotonous.

Developing Optimal Timing Strategies

Mastering the timing hinges on recognizing patterns in the vehicle movement. Rather than reacting to each car individually, skilled players learn to anticipate the flow of traffic. They can identify safe windows for crossing by observing the distance between vehicles and their relative speeds. A crucial element is understanding the game’s inherent randomization. While patterns exist, they are not always consistent. This requires players to be adaptable and avoid relying on fixed strategies. Successfully navigating the challenges demands a blend of foresight, reaction speed, and a degree of calculated risk-taking. It’s about finding the balance between waiting for a perfect opportunity and seizing a momentary chance before it disappears.

Enhancing Gameplay with Power-Ups and Obstacles

Many iterations of the chicken crossing concept add layers of complexity through the introduction of power-ups and obstacles. Power-ups can provide temporary advantages, such as increased speed, invincibility, or the ability to briefly slow down traffic. These additions introduce a strategic element beyond simple timing. Players must decide when to use these power-ups for maximum effect, balancing their desire for safety with the potential for maximizing their score or reaching a distant goal. Obstacles, aside from the traffic itself, could include things like potholes, oil slicks, or even hungry foxes, adding further challenges to the journey. They force players to be even more attentive and responsive, requiring quick adjustments to their trajectory.

Implementing Strategic Power-Up Usage

Effective power-up use isn’t about simply activating them as soon as they appear. The most skilled players reserve them for particularly challenging sections of the road, or for situations where a risky crossing is unavoidable. For example, an invincibility power-up might be ideal for navigating a dense cluster of vehicles, while a speed boost could be used to quickly traverse a long, open stretch of road. Learning the duration and limitations of each power-up is crucial. Some power-ups may only last for a few seconds, while others might have a limited number of uses. This necessitates careful planning and a keen understanding of the game’s mechanics

  • Prioritize power-ups for high-risk sections of the road.
  • Understand the duration and limitations of each power-up.
  • Don't waste power-ups on easy crossings.
  • Anticipate traffic patterns to maximize power-up effectiveness.

Utilizing these strategies ensures players get the most out of the temporary advantages the game provides, increasing their chances of reaching the other side.

The Role of Score Systems and High Score Tables

A well-designed score system is vital for maintaining player engagement. Points are typically awarded for each successful crossing, with bonus points often given for risky maneuvers or achieving specific milestones. The implementation of a high score table adds a competitive dimension to the game, motivating players to continually improve their performance and strive for the top spot. Knowing that their score is publicly visible encourages players to refine their techniques and push their limits. Many games incorporate multipliers into their scoring systems, rewarding players for consecutive successful crossings or for collecting specific items. The pursuit of a high score transforms a simple game into a challenging and rewarding competition.

Analyzing Scoring Mechanisms for Improvement

Understanding the game's scoring system is essential for maximizing your score. Identifying which actions are rewarded most generously allows players to focus on those strategies. For example, if the game awards bonus points for narrowly avoiding collisions, players might be encouraged to take calculated risks. Alternatively, if the game prioritizes consistent, safe crossings, players might adopt a more cautious approach. Analyzing the scoring mechanics provides valuable insights into the game’s design and helps players develop effective strategies for achieving a high score. It’s about discovering the optimal balance between risk and reward within the specific rules of the game.

  1. Identify actions that yield the highest point values.
  2. Determine the conditions for bonus points and multipliers.
  3. Adjust your gameplay strategy to capitalize on scoring opportunities.
  4. Practice risky maneuvers to improve your timing and precision.

By systematically analyzing the scoring mechanisms, players can unlock their full potential and compete effectively on the high score table.

The Evolution of the Chicken Crossing Genre

The initial concept of a chicken crossing a road has evolved significantly over time. Early versions were often simple, pixelated games with limited features. However, modern iterations incorporate more sophisticated graphics, complex gameplay mechanics, and a wider range of power-ups and obstacles. Some games introduce different characters beyond the classic chicken, each with unique abilities or challenges. Others incorporate elements of puzzle-solving or resource management. The genre has also expanded to include multiplayer modes, allowing players to compete against each other in real-time. The core premise remains the same, but the execution has become increasingly creative and engaging.
